Ozzy And Sharon Osbourne Defend Israel Concert: ‘We’ll Play Where We Want’

JL;DR SUMMARY Legendary rock musician Ozzy Osbourne, accompanied by his wife Sharon, has affirmed his decision to perform in Israel, dismissing pressures from the Boycott, Divestment, Sanctions (BDS) movement.
